Hewlett Packard Enterprise seeks a Partner Business Manager for Print to manage enterprise client accounts and drive growth. You will develop strategic account plans, coordinate across marketing, support, and product teams, and leverage data-driven insights to inform decisions.
You will manage the sales pipeline, focus on retention and renewals, and provide regular management updates on revenue, client satisfaction, and performance metrics.
This role is responsible for managing enterprise client accounts, understanding their needs, and driving growth. The role creates strategic plans, coordinates with various teams, and leverages data-driven insights to support decision-making. The role manages sales pipelines, ensures customer retention and contract renewals, and provides regular updates to management.
